Along with Colleen, Waterford Crystal Lismore must rank as the most enduring design in the history of the company. Its appeal transcends concepts of the traditional and the contemporary. Lismore was first designed by Miroslav Havel in 1952. It was inspired by the architecture of Lismore Castle. The diamond shaped coss-cutting echos the leaded windows of the catle and the upright tear-shaped cuts recall the castle’s stately turrets. In recent years, Waterford have brought the Lismore design even more up to date with Lismore Essence. This twent first century interpretation of the original Lismore design beautifully compliments its older sister and brings to perfect completion this most beautiful crystal design.
